Juan Luis Guerra suffers technical failures in concert and users pronounce: “It is a crime to give him the same treatment as those of the Reggaetón Lima Festival”


The Dominican singer Juan Luis Guerra was expected for months by his Peruvian fans and last night he delighted the public with a spectacular show at the San Marcos Stadium that began at 9 pm

However, he was not oblivious to the technical problems that occurred in the concert, as happened with his colleagues Ivy Queen and Lunay at the Reggaetón Lima Festival, running out of audio on two occasions and commenting on it with the public.

The singer-songwriter was totally transparent with his audience and thanked them for their patience, which generated applause and understanding for the great professional. “The technician says that it is a fiber optic cable that has been damaged twice. But… we have the most beautiful public, applause!” he said Juan Luis Guerra to the crowd.

Comments from the followers of Juan Luis Guerra during the concert.

However, what most shocked his fans was his willingness to continue the show and do “the impossible” so that everyone gets a pleasant presentation. Among the most prominent comments from fans on Twitter, the following could be read: “Everything professional and calm and thanking the public,” read a tweet.

Likewise, there were also the followers of the Dominican who could not believe that Juan Luis Guerra have used the same equipment, but seen from a way of apologizing to the artist and not reproaching him. “They used the same sound equipment knowing that they had problems recently,” says a frustrated user.

What did Juan Luis Guerra say after his show in Lima?

Very different from what was thought, Juan Luis Guerra has shown a position of gratitude and good vibes with his Peruvian public for their patience and calm with the technical failures in the concert of the St. Mark’s Stadium. He even posted a photo shoot on his Instagram account of people loving him who came to see him and sing along to his songs.

Publication by Juan Luis Guerra after a concert at the San Marcos Stadium.

“What a great privilege to have an audience like the one in Lima! We sang and they chanted for us and our hearts overflowed with joy! Yes, we can! Thank you Peru!”, he wrote in the description of the photos.
